### Step 4: Currency rounding

Quotelark converts prices via the Ferrow rates feed. All math is integer minor units; never use floats. Rounding mode is banker's rounding, set by `QL_ROUND_MODE=half_even`. If totals drift by a cent, check that the conversion happens once at checkout, not per line item. Mismatched rounding between the cart service and the ledger is the usual culprit. The rates feed itself needs signed requests, so the worker's env file must carry the feed credential on the next line.

secret setting of yafof-tawep: RELAY_SECRET8=8abb5772

CI note: dark-mode visual diffs for the Oxbow admin dashboard fail intermittently on the snapshot stage. Cause: the theme toggle persists via localStorage, and the headless runner reuses profiles between shards, so some screenshots render in the wrong theme. No data exposure — styling only. Fix: clear storage in the test bootstrap. Flagging for security review since the bootstrap change touches session setup. The affected build is identified below.

trace token, fafog-kageg: htk4_98e6

## Spreadsheet Exports — Memory Notes

The Tablemint export worker streams rows instead of buffering whole workbooks, keeping memory under 300 MB even for large tenants. If you see spikes, check for plugins forcing full materialization. To run the export profiler locally, authenticate against the internal metering service with the key below.

service key, fawip-bajef: kto11_Qt5wZK9vdNC

Fan-out backpressure for the Quillet notifier: when the queue depth crosses the soft limit, the dispatcher sheds low-priority pushes and batches the rest at 500ms intervals. Reviewer should confirm the shed counter is exported and that retries respect the jitter window. Once merged, the release artifact gets re-signed by the pipeline, which expects the deploy key shown below.

deploy key for bawep-yawif: bky6_GQhaSt